建军节

jiàn jūn jié
noun★Intermediate— Army Day
formal

A national holiday in China commemorating the founding of the People's Liberation Army (PLA) on August 1, 1927.

每年八月一日是中国的建军节。

August 1st is Army Day in China every year.

建军节当天,部队会举行庆祝活动。

On Army Day, the military holds celebration events.

💡

The date marks the start of the Nanchang Uprising in 1927, which led to the formation of the Red Army, predecessor of the PLA.

📖Word Origin

The term '建军节' (jiàn jūn jié) combines '建' (jiàn, 'to establish'), '军' (jūn, 'military/army'), and '节' (jié, 'festival/day'). It was first designated as a national holiday in 1933 during the Chinese Soviet Republic era and has been observed annually since.

📝Usage Notes

Always capitalized as 'Army Day' in English. The holiday is primarily observed by military personnel and veterans, with public events including parades, concerts, and media broadcasts commemorating military history.
